The Spazmatics features all the awesome sounds, styles, and way cool dance steps from the 1980s ...Ticket Exchanges. All tickets are non-refundable. Tickets may be exchanged up to 72 hours prior to the show/performance for a fee of $5 per ticket. Subscribers receive free ticket exchanges . The value of the exchanged ticket (s) will be applied to another Center event in the current season. We cannot hold a credit on your account. Midland Center for the Arts is a performing arts center and museum complex located in on 1801 Saint Andrews St in Midland, Michigan. It includes two performance venues, two museums, art studios, lecture halls and a historical campus. The member groups at the center are the Alden B. Dow Museum of Science & Art, Center Stage Choirs, Center Stage ...
